Pita Chip is a Middle Eastern fast-casual restaurant located on Market Street. They serve fresh falafel, succulent shawarma, and vibrant veggies, making it an ideal destination for anyone looking for Mediterranean cuisine or sandwich options. Middle Eastern restaurants are known for their flavorful and aromatic dishes that are sure to satisfy your cravings. Pita Chip, located on Market Street in Philadelphia, is a Middle Eastern fast-casual restaurant that serves up fresh and delicious falafel, shawarma, and veggies.
One of the standout items on their menu is the extra crispy falafel, which can be enjoyed in a wrap or bowl. The tender beef shawarma is also a must-try, served with tasty toppings and crispy fries. Whether you prefer a wrap or bowl, Pita Chip has got you covered.
In addition to their mouth-watering food offerings, Pita Chip also offers exciting promotions and events throughout the year. They recently teamed up with The North Broad Renaissance for the Summer aBroad series, offering free sides of their award-winning falafel with any entree purchase every Thursday at their Temple location.
